Output 3a150bf65a4d30652bfcfef6125ced64f2d6e042aa9c8ba5fed7c3492d78cef4:1

value
983862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565b5494ab328c28b5c73b66e1896f0a2096c68a OP_EQUAL
address
39ZdSnfcwi7NA7fZH1pp2Rt4bYSB7p8znd
transaction
3a150bf65a4d30652bfcfef6125ced64f2d6e042aa9c8ba5fed7c3492d78cef4
spent
true